RG6 Coaxial Cable
RG6 is a type of coaxial cable widely used for transmitting high-frequency signals, such as those in cable television, satellite TV, and broadband internet. It features a thicker center conductor and better shielding than older standards like RG59, making it ideal for high-speed data and video transmission.
Connector Type (RG6)
RG6 connectors are standardized fittings used to terminate the end of an RG6 cable. The most common types include F-type connectors (screw-on or compression) and BNC connectors, though the latter are less common in modern residential installations.

RG6 Cable
A type of coaxial cable with a 75-ohm impedance, designed for high-frequency signal transmission. Commonly used in cable TV, satellite systems, and CCTV installations.
Coaxial Connector
A type of electrical connector used to join coaxial cables to devices. Common types include F-type, BNC, and DIN connectors.
Signal Loss (Insertion Loss)
The reduction in signal strength as it passes through a connector or cable. Lower insertion loss is better for maintaining signal quality over distance.
Shielding (Braid & Foil)
Protective layers in coaxial cables that reduce electromagnetic interference (EMI). High shielding effectiveness ensures better signal reliability.
